Principal Product Manager for Identity at PayJoy, leading strategies for global customer verification and onboarding. Collaborating with engineering and data teams to deliver secure identity solutions.
Responsibilities
Lead product strategy and execution for PayJoy’s identity systems — defining how we verify, trust, and onboard users securely across markets.
Bring clarity to complexity by framing ambiguous problems, building structured roadmaps, and aligning teams around clear, measurable outcomes.
Collaborate cross-functionally with engineering, data science, design, risk, and operations to build scalable, reliable identity verification and fraud prevention capabilities.
Deeply understand customer and market needs to design identity experiences that balance trust, compliance, and conversion.
Translate abstract goals into actionable plans—defining success metrics, driving prioritization, and ensuring delivery quality at scale.
Learn and adapt quickly, diving into new technologies, regulations, and ecosystems to inform decisions with rigor and data.
Drive operational excellence, ensuring the right balance between risk management and user experience while supporting global expansion.
Influence across levels, partnering with senior leadership to define strategy and champion identity as a core enabler of PayJoy’s mission.
Requirements
7+ years of product management experience, including ownership of complex, cross-functional initiatives that span engineering, data, and operations.
Strong generalist product management skills, with depth in strategy, execution, and stakeholder alignment. Systems-level thinker who can connect customer needs, business goals, and technical architecture into a coherent roadmap.
Analytical and data-driven — able to define success metrics, interpret data, and use insights to guide decisions.
Exceptional communication and collaboration skills, with a track record of influencing across senior stakeholders and diverse teams.
Comfortable in high-ambiguity, high-growth environments where priorities evolve rapidly and judgment matters more than playbooks.
Benefits
100% Company-funded Health and dental and vision discount plan for employees and immediate family members.
Life insurance.
Phone finance, Headphone, home office equipment and wellnes perks.
